Power Your Home with Solar: Residential Water Pump Options
Solar energy is a versatile way to power your home, and residential water pumps are an increasingly common application. Using solar panels to drive your water pump offers numerous benefits, including diminished energy costs and a smaller carbon footprint. There are several types of residential water pumps that can be powered by solar energy, each with its own advantages.
- Deep Well Pumps: These pumps are ideal for water sources at a distance and are known for their power.
- Above-Ground Pumps: These pumps are often used for shallower wells or irrigation systems, offering a easier installation process.
When choosing a solar-powered water pump, it's vital to consider factors such as your demand for water, the depth of your well, and the solar exposure at your location.

Setting Up Your Solar Water Heater at Home: A Guide to Installation and Care
Installing a solar water heating system in your home is a excellent way to reduce energy costs and be more eco-friendly. While the initial investment can be considerable, the long-term payoffs make it a sound option. The process of installation typically involves placing solar collectors on your roof, connecting them to a storage tank, and linking the system with your existing water supply.
Regular maintenance is crucial to ensure your solar water heater operates efficiently. This includes examining the collectors and pipes for wear and tear, removing debris from the system, and observing the water temperature. By adhering to these simple maintenance steps, you can maximize the lifespan of your solar water heater and enjoy years of consistent hot water.
